Wally and I are gonna run out to the High Desert Roundup area in Stoddard Valley, about 10 miles south of Barstow California, off Highway 247.
We are mainly going to find and run the Devils Loop trail. I would rate it as an Easy/Moderate w/ bypasses. We have had mild KJ's on it in the past.

We had a great run on April 11th out in Stoddard wells ohv area. We ran the Devils Loop trail and some other stretches of trail that lead out to Achey Breakey (though we passed on that section) and some of us also ran Costly Canyon. We had a little carnage along the way, a little spotting and deployed the strap once but it was a blast and everyone had a great time and wheeled well.

After finishing up DL we headed for some trails that can lead to Achey Breakey but we passed on that trail this time. Some great hill climbs including cresting the top of a steep hill w/ only blue sky and clouds to look at, we continued down to run Costly Canyon, a short stretch of harder up canyon terrain w/ good size rocks. Lacking many pics of that stretch as we had too much fun staying moving and everyone that tried it cruised through w/ no trouble.
